New Inn Close is in Fownhope, Hereford and in South Herefordshire district. HR1 4PP is located in the Backbury elect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of North Herefordshire. This postcode has been in use since 1995-12-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ding HR1 4PP,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 52.2%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of HR1 4PP there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 58.9%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Safety

Is New Inn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around New Inn Close was 51.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 45.6% higher than the Backbury average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

New Inn Close has the 4th highest crime rate of 24 local areas in Backbury and the 224th highest crime rate of 626 local areas in Herefordshire, County of .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 25.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-16.9%.

Employment

HR1 4PP area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 10%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 15%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

HR1 4PP area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in HR1 4PP area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 39%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
